Frequently asked questions
On average, a new car can depreciate by approximately 23% after the first year, reflecting the premium paid for new technology and immediate depreciation once it's considered used.
While a VIN decoder can provide the model year that can suggest warranty status, verifying the actual warranty status usually requires direct contact with the manufacturer or dealer.
Our reports might specify the point of impact and damage location on the 2006 HYUNDAI vehicle, offering a clearer understanding of the accident, if such details are available.
A VIN decoder can provide detailed information about a 2006 HYUNDAI SONATA, including its manufacturing location, model year, engine type, and equipment details.
A flood or lemon title, if reported, indicates significant past issues, which are detailed in our reports to inform potential buyers of the risks associated with such vehicles.
Car depreciation is the decrease in value of a vehicle over time. It's a crucial factor to consider when calculating the total cost of vehicle ownership.
Technology plays a significant role in the depreciation of vehicles, as models with outdated tech depreciate faster due to lower consumer demand for older features.
